Percy wasn't the brave, handsome one. That was Bill.

Nor was he the daredevil, talented Quidditch player; Charlie.

He wasn't the funny one, quick with a joke or prank. That would be the twins.

Nor was he Molly Weasley's secret favorite, though she would never admit harboring a preference for any child over the other. But everyone knew she favored Ron. He was her youngest boy and had been the smallest baby; premature, two months early and no bigger than a puffskein.

And he certainly wasn't Ginny, the lone Weasley girl-- though the twins had often accused him of being soft like a girl.

No, he was Percy. Stick in the mud, prefect Percy with his penchant for rules and regulations. Percy, who wore glasses and always felt slightly out of place at the Weasley family dinners. An introvert among extroverts; the lone Weasley boy who thought before he spoke-- most of the time. With Penelope around, he found that his brain simply didn't want to cooperate.

He hadn't wanted to tell her about growing up Weasley. She was a Muggleborn and a Ravenclaw; unlike the rest of the magical world, she didn't know that red hair and secondhand possessions equated second-tier status to some, despite their long wizarding lineage. Penelope hadn't known, and he didn't want her to think less of him because of his family.

Merlin, he'd been such a prick.

Miraculously, she hadn't cared. She'd even empathized. He hadn't known what it was like growing up for her, the eldest child; a girl when her parents wanted a boy. A social mountaineer for a mother, who watched the peerage the way some wizards watched for phoenixes, and a loving but detached father. Two Muggle brothers who resented their sister for being different.

They were much more alike than he'd ever thought. And Penelope, she liked him despite the "broomstick up his arse," as the twins had so eloquently put it. She liked hearing his stories about the Burrow, about living in a family where chaos was the norm.

"What's your favorite memory?"

"What sort of question is that?"

"One I want you to answer, or there'll be no more snogging until after exams."

"That's cruel, Penelope."

"I am a harsh mistress, Percy."

"Okay, fine... it would have to be the time I made my brother laugh so hard he snorted food out of his nose."

"You can't snort food out your nose, that's ridiculous."

"Yes, you can. It happened!"

"You're having me on."

"Well, technically it was tomato soup, but that's still food, and Charlie was laughing so hard it flew out of his nostrils and hit Great Auntie Muriel right on the nose."

He never told her that he didn't remember what he'd done that made Charlie laugh that hard, but she never asked. In that moment, he had been the funny one, and he'd never forgotten that night.

He'd never forgotten the snog he'd gotten for his troubles, either.
